Crawl Space Solutions
In the greater Virginia Beach area, many of the homes are built with crawl space areas and not basements. For a long time, these were constructed with vents which was intended to increase fresh air flow into the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. Having open vents allows water to get in when it rains or snows and the vents prevent proper evaporation which results in the humidity level staying too high which will eventually facilitate the growth of mildew. Studies have shown that up to ½ of the air in your home has come up through the crawl space so having the space closed off from the outside and keeping the humidity levels low can improve the overall air quality in your home.
Our team has been enclosing crawl spaces since we opened our doors and we know the best way to seal them off and control the humidity. We do this using a process known as encapsulation which is the installation of a series of vapor barriers,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, which are thick plastic and vinyl sheeting as well as vent covers and a sturdy door that can close off the area totally and stop any excess moisture from entering. Closing the area will also stop bugs and animals from getting in the crawl space which will keep any items there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After the crawl space is protected, if necessary we can install a series of floor jacks to repair sagging floors in your home.
Structural Foundation Repair
Your homes foundation is quite possibly one of the most important parts. It not only holds the home itself but it also creates the basement walls. If you've got foundation problems, usually, they will manifest themselves in the form of stair stepping cracks in the outside brickwork, long cracks that run the length of the foundation or along basement walls. You may also notice that the windows and doors will not open or close easily or there may be c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these problems seem critical at first, they are all indicators of a sinking or settling foundation which should be looked at by a professional for problems and determine if a repair needs to be performed.
It is good that many foundation problems stem from similar issues and our professionals are very good at noticing those issues. We can utilize a repair product that is for your particular issue to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ation. If you've got a uneven foundation, we can install a series of foundation piers to stabilize the foundation. Depending on how bad it is and where it is, we will use either helical piers or push piers. Both are very strong and can help stabilize your foundation.
